Click the Data tab's Data Analysis command button to tell Excel that you want to calculate descriptive statistics. ... In Data Analysis dialog box, highlight the Descriptive Statistics entry in the Analysis Tools list and then click OK.
Select a range of cells. Select the Quick Analysis button that appears at the bottom right corner of the selected data. Or, press Ctrl + Q. Select Charts. Hover over the chart types to preview a chart, and then select the chart you want.
Click the File tab, click Options, and then click the Add-Ins category. ... In the Manage box, select Excel Add-ins and then click Go. ... In the Add-Ins box, check the Analysis ToolPak check box, and then click OK.
